Investigation showed the new parallel sort in the aggregation layer was not stable: rows with equal keys swapped positions depending on worker scheduling. Customers relying on positional diffs saw spurious changes. We reverted to the stable merge path at 10:17 and confirmed deterministic output across fifty repeated runs. For the weekly sync, note that the regression shipped in the build identified immediately below.

trace token, fafog-kageg: htk4_98e6

## GC Pauses in Matchline

Matchline's order-matching loop stalls whenever the young-gen collector runs during peak fill windows. P99 match latency jumps from 4ms to 38ms. We can't move to a pauseless collector this quarter, so we're shrinking allocation pressure instead: pooled order objects, pre-sized ring buffers, and a hard cap on speculative match candidates. Benchmarks on the Veldport staging cluster show pauses under 6ms with these settings. Review the constants carefully; they're load-bearing. The current tuning values are as follows.

constants for bagag-fawip:
BUDGETS = {
    "wenius": 400,
    "brieth": 224,
    "rusath": 783,
    "eliys": 187,
    "aldax": 737,
    "ralion": 818,
    "istius": 153,
}

## Changelog — Crumbline v2.8

The setting `ORDER_CUTOFF` has been renamed to `BAKERY_CUTOFF_LOCAL_TIME` to clarify that it is interpreted in each shop's local timezone, not server time. Migration happens automatically on upgrade, but customers who pin their env files must update manually. When editing, place the renamed key immediately before the ordering service credential, on the line that follows this sentence.

vault entry, yahif-yajep: COURIER_KEY29=b802bdf8034096b65a51c6ba5abe2

# Donation-receipt mailer (Almsgate) env.
# On-call: restart only via the supervisor script; direct restarts drop the send queue.
# Receipts retry 3x, then land in the dead-letter bucket for manual replay.
# Outbound sending requires the mailer credential from the Almsgate vault.
# Paste that credential on the line directly below this comment block.

vault entry, kagep-yajeg: COURIER_KEY5=da097